Double glazing
Double glazing is a fantastic method to increase the thermal efficiency of your home. Double glazing consists of two panes, with an insulation gap between them. This allows warm air to remain inside your home, while cold air escapes, thus reducing heating bills. It also reduces noise and condensation and makes your home a more comfortable living space. Double glazed windows are more durable than single-pane windows and are less likely to break.
The space between the two panes of glass in double glazed windows is filled with argon gas. This gas has lower thermal conductivity than air, which helps to keep your home warm. It can also help to reduce noise levels which is crucial if you live near a freeway or airport. The type of frame you choose can also impact the effectiveness of double glazing.
Double-glazed windows aren't just an excellent way to insulate your home, but they also boost its value. This kind of window is also easier to maintain than single-glazed windows. They are safer than single-paned windows since they are constructed with two layers. You can also use laminated or hardened glass for additional security.
Double-glazed windows can also cut down on outside noise. The glass is thicker and can reduce the amount of noise that enters into a home. This is especially beneficial if you are living close to a busy highway, an airport or noisy neighbours.
Most homeowners will find double glazing an investment worth it. However it is essential to weigh the pros and cons of this investment prior to making a final decision. It is also important to think about your budget and the length of time you plan to remain in the home. Double-glazed windows are more expensive than single-glazed windows however they can help you save money on energy bills and improve your home's appearance.

Casement windows
While sliders and single-hung windows remain the most sought-after window styles Casement windows are worth considering in the event that you're looking for an efficient option in terms of energy consumption. They open on hinges like doors and can be cranked left or right to allow top-to-bottom airflow. They can be open wide to allow side-toside ventilation.
These windows are known for their exceptional energy efficiency and are perfect for those who want to cut down on cooling and heating costs. They are sealed tightly when closed, reducing air infiltration. This can reduce the cost of your home's utilities and the energy usage. In addition, they offer great wind protection since the sash is open and acts as a flap that funnels fresh breezes into your living areas.
Casement windows are also less difficult to clean than sliding or double-hung windows. They don't have sashes that are able to move upwards and downwards in the frame. Instead, they open angled outward and are easy to reach for cleaning.
However, it is important to keep in mind that casement windows are vulnerable to strong gusts of wind, which could cause them to break if they are placed in the wrong position. It is therefore important to install them in areas that can withstand windy weather conditions.
Casement windows are not just more energy-efficient and energy-efficient, but they also provide an ideal choice for families with pets or small children. This is because they contain fewer parts and don't extend as far as a sliding or double-hung window, making them less likely to injure a child or pet.
Additionally, casement windows feature sleek window specialist london frames that will complement any home style. They also offer an improved view of the outside landscape. There are also more designs and materials available. You can also choose decorative muntins which are strips made of vinyl, wood, or metal. These strips visually divide large sashes into smaller sashes. Muntins come in functional and non-functional styles and can be added to a wide range of window types.
